A Method of TDOA Measurement in Multi-station Locating System

2019 
A method of TDOA (Time Difference Of Arrival) measurement in multi-station locating system is designed, which is synchronized by high-precision synchronization signal. The main station detects and generates reference signal, broadcasts it to the slave stations. According to this reference signal, each station completes time difference measurement by combining time domain wavelets transform and frequency domain crosscorrelation algorithm. This method can effectively improve the time difference measurement accuracy of BPSK signal, QPSK signal and FSK-PSK compound modulation signal. In this paper, the hardware implementation of time difference measurement based on FPGA is presented. The simulation and measurement results of different signal types under different SNR conditions are compared and analyzed. The validity and feasibility of this method are verified.
